4.3 Web Series and Short Dramas

Platforms like YouTube Originals and WeTV produce mini-dramas (10–15 min episodes) targeting Gen Z with themes of romance, boarding school life, and religious dilemmas.

3. Prank and Social Experiment (Prank Eksperimen)

While pranks are global, Indonesia has elevated the social experiment prank. Videos with titles like "Tinggalin HP 1 Juta di Alfamart" (Leaving a 1 Million Rupiah phone at the convenience store) test the honesty of the public. Or, the classic "Pacar Orang" (Someone else's boyfriend/girlfriend) setup where an attractive actor flirts with a taken person to test their loyalty. These videos blur ethical lines but drive massive engagement.
